Frederick, Colorado

Interactive maps of population, income, age, housing, education and health for Frederick, Colorado, beside the state and national figures.

StatisticFrederickColoradoUnited States
Total Population16,6515,862,189334,922,499
Median Household Income$129,460$95,470$80,734
Median Age36.437.738.9
Bachelor's Degree or Higher38.5%45.7%35.7%
Median Home Value$568,300$539,400$332,700
Median Gross Rent$2,381$1,761$1,413
Poverty Rate3.3%9.4%12.5%
Unemployment Rate3.4%4.6%5.2%
Foreign Born4.6%9.8%14.1%
Homeownership Rate95.0%66.2%65.2%
Average Commute Time32.025.226.4
Worked from Home20.0%21.0%15.1%
Married-Couple Households69.4%48.3%46.9%

Age in Frederick, Colorado

StatisticFrederickColoradoUnited States
Median Age36.437.738.9
Under 18 %26.5%21.0%22.0%
Age 18-24 %4.8%9.1%9.1%
Age 25-34 %15.8%15.7%13.7%
Age 35-44 %17.4%14.6%13.2%
Age 45-64 %23.9%23.9%24.8%
Age 65 and Over %11.5%15.6%17.2%

Households and families in Frederick, Colorado

StatisticFrederickColoradoUnited States
Households5,7772,374,218129,227,496
Average Household Size2.92.42.5
Family Households80.8%61.7%64.2%
Households with Children43.8%28.4%29.5%
Single-Parent Families11.4%13.4%17.3%
People Living Alone12.3%28.6%28.7%
Never Married22.8%33.1%34.4%

Income and poverty in Frederick, Colorado

StatisticFrederickColoradoUnited States
Per Capita Income$50,814$52,636$44,673
Households Under $25,0004.1%11.2%14.6%
Households $50,000 to $74,9999.9%14.6%15.5%
Households $100,000 to $149,99928.2%19.2%17.5%
Households $200,000 or More20.2%17.0%13.4%
Poverty Rate3.3%9.4%12.5%
Below 200% of Poverty10.2%22.0%28.2%
SNAP Households2.6%8.5%n/a

Housing in Frederick, Colorado

StatisticFrederickColoradoUnited States
Housing Units5,9302,589,053143,775,355
Single-Family Detached Homes95.3%61.4%61.3%
Buildings with 5+ Units1.2%22.6%19.1%
Vacancy Rate2.6%8.3%10.1%
Median Year Structure Built2,008.01,988.01,980.0
Renter-Occupied5.0%33.8%34.8%
Rent as % of Household Income31.0%31.4%30.6%
Median Property Tax$3,255$2,602n/a

Education in Frederick, Colorado

StatisticFrederickColoradoUnited States
Less than High School4.8%7.1%10.4%
High School Graduate23.5%19.7%26.0%
Some College or Associate Degree33.3%27.4%27.9%
Bachelor's Degree24.7%28.1%21.6%
Graduate or Professional Degree13.8%17.6%14.1%

Work and commuting in Frederick, Colorado

StatisticFrederickColoradoUnited States
Labour Force Participation75.9%68.6%63.5%
Drove Alone to Work71.0%65.1%68.8%
Public Transit0.3%1.6%3.2%
Walked to Work0.8%2.5%2.4%
Commutes Under 15 Minutes14.7%26.5%26.0%
Commutes Over an Hour7.3%6.8%8.6%
Households Without a Car1.9%5.2%n/a

Origins and language in Frederick, Colorado

StatisticFrederickColoradoUnited States
Born in State of Residence51.9%41.2%57.3%
Naturalised Citizens3.1%4.7%7.4%
Non-Citizens1.5%5.2%6.8%
Speaks Only English at Home89.8%83.8%77.7%
Speaks Spanish at Home7.3%11.1%13.6%
Limited English Proficiency8.2%12.7%16.7%
